利用人工智能(AI)技术使长方形逐渐倾斜,我们可以从多个角度进行探讨。以下是一些可能的方法和技术,以及它们的潜在应用和挑战:
一、基于深度学习的图像处理技术
1. 卷积神经网络:通过训练一个卷积神经网络来识别长方形的形状特征,并学习如何将其从一个初始状态转换为倾斜状态。这种网络可以从简单的几何形状开始,逐步学会调整其形状以适应更复杂的情况。
2. 生成对抗网络:GANs可以用来生成新的长方形图像,这些图像是随机选择的初始形状经过一系列变换后的结果。通过不断地训练和优化,可以使得生成的长方形图像逐渐呈现出倾斜的效果。
3. 注意力机制:在处理图像时,使用注意力机制可以帮助模型更加关注于长方形的关键部分,从而促进其向倾斜方向的变化。
二、基于机器学习的图像变形技术
1. 图像分割与形态学操作:使用图像分割算法将长方形从背景中分离出来,然后通过形态学操作如膨胀和腐蚀来改变其形状。这种方法虽然简单,但效果可能不够自然。
2. 深度学习驱动的变形模型:设计一个深度学习模型,该模型能够理解长方形的基本结构,并根据输入的新条件(例如旋转、缩放或倾斜)自动调整其形状。这种方法需要大量的标注数据来训练模型,并且可能需要复杂的网络架构来实现高级的形状变化。
三、实时图形处理软件
1. 实时渲染引擎:开发一个实时渲染引擎,该引擎能够在用户界面上显示长方形的初始状态,并提供一个简单的接口让用户能够控制长方形的旋转和平移。
2. 交互式工具:集成一个交互式工具,允许用户拖动长方形的边缘来观察其倾斜效果。这个工具应该能够提供反馈,告诉用户他们正在做什么,并且能够保存和加载他们的工作。
四、增强现实与虚拟现实中的倾斜效果
1. 增强现实应用:在AR应用中,可以利用AI技术使长方形在现实世界中逐渐倾斜,为用户提供沉浸式的体验。
2. 虚拟现实应用:在VR应用中,可以利用AI技术使长方形在虚拟环境中逐渐倾斜,为用户提供更加真实的视觉体验。
总的来说,利用AI技术使长方形逐渐倾斜是一个具有挑战性的任务,需要结合多种技术手段和方法。随着AI技术的不断发展,相信未来会有更多创新的方法和技术出现,为人们带来更多惊喜。